Partial restoration of chiral symmetry, as indicated by a reduction of the quark condensate in matter, could significantly alter the properties of nucleons and mesons. Various signals of these effects are discussed: enhancement of the axial charge of a nucleon, lepton pair production and $\overline K$-nucleus attraction.
